ConductAtlas Analysis

Why it matters (compliance & governance perspective)

The assignment is irrevocable and permanent, meaning users cannot reclaim any rights in submitted material, and the scope covers not only copyright but moral rights and any other rights.

Consumer impact (what this means for users)

If you submit material to Visa.com, you permanently and irrevocably lose all copyrights, moral rights, and any other rights you had in that material, and you can never assert those rights again.

▸ View Original Clause Language DOCUMENT RECORD
"
By submitting material to Visa.com, you irrevocably transfer and assign to Visa, and forever waive and agree never to assert, any copyrights, "moral" rights, or other rights that you may have in such material.

Excerpt from Visa's Terms of Use
